Gov. Dapo Abiodun congratulates BBNaija winner, Laycon

The Governor of Ogun State, Adedapo Abiodun has reacted to Laycon’s emergence as winner of BBNaija season 5 reality TV show.

Taking to Instagram to express himself, the 60 year old wrote;

“I am delighted to congratulate one of our own in Ogun State, Olamilekan Agbelesebioba, AKA @itslaycon for emerging winner of Big Brother Naija Lockdown. The pacesetter that you are, you have emerged one of the best in academic and social engagements, so this victory is aptly a confirmation of your brilliance, intellect and maturity.

Our Administration will continue to support and empower the youth via numerous channels, towards inclusion, job creation, and the utility of our natural youthful energy. Youths of Ogun State, Nigeria, Africa and in fact the world over, see you as the face of positive revolution in the history of African entertainment. #BuildingOurFutureTogether #ISEYA”
